Pesticides (Control) Act 1993 (Cap. 226). Country/Territory Vanuatu Document type Legislation Date 1993 (2006) Source FAO, FAOLEX Long titleAn Act to make provisions for the regulation and control of the importation, manufacture, sale, distribution and use of pesticides, and for matters connected therewith. Subject Cultivated plants Keyword Pesticides Biological agents Institution Registration International trade Authorization/permit Inspection Offences/penalties Basic legislation Geographical area Least Developed Countries, Oceania, Small Island Developing States Abstract This Act establishes a Pesticides Committee under section 2. Section 3 provides that the officer who holds the office of the Principal Plant Protection Officer in the Department of Agriculture shall be the Registrar of Pesticides.
